Background Info

Weather
Yecheon experiences a temperate climate with hot summers and cold winters. Summer temperatures range from 20°C to 30°C, while winter temperatures can drop to -10°C. Yecheon receives moderate rainfall throughout the year, with higher precipitation levels in the summer months. Humidity levels vary but can be high, especially in the summer. Air quality in Yecheon is generally good, with clean air and minimal pollution.

Language
The local language spoken in Yecheon is Korean. English may not be widely spoken, so it’s helpful to learn some basic Korean phrases for communication.

Cost Of Living
The cost of living in Yecheon is relatively affordable compared to major cities in South Korea. Daily expenses such as food, transportation, and accommodation are reasonable, making Yecheon a budget-friendly destination for travelers.
